Output 27bba6042eb87472ee127b6f2969ffe8a0a37d8f7fd150dbf267ead46b485d51:1

value
25455352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a1e8f7e6c29d598aafc5078df2461185b94fcd2 OP_EQUAL
address
34586uwvS1V96X5NCc2zBpz7b96EcVzr8P
transaction
27bba6042eb87472ee127b6f2969ffe8a0a37d8f7fd150dbf267ead46b485d51
spent
true